2012 Interior Motives School League Report
Thu, 27 Sep 2012In addition to showcasing the talent of student designers, the 2012 Interior Motives Design Awards acknowledged for the first time the achievements of the schools that nurtured them with its inaugural ‘Most Successful School' award. After a close-run battle with Italy's Istituto Europeo di Design (IED) that was eventually decided by just a single point, the award went to London's Royal College of Art. This one-off award for the RCA is backed up by CDN's league table of school success over the past five years, which has now been updated to include the results from the 2012 Interior Motives Design Awards.
2015 Volkswagen Touareg unveiled prior to Beijing motor show debut
Thu, 17 Apr 2014Volkswagen has given the second-generation Touareg an update, and it's bringing the refreshed SUV to the Beijing motor show next week. The Touareg has been a solid global success for Volkswagen with over 720,000 units sold, despite all the ink expended discussing its pricing (especially compared to the rest of the automaker's range), and the company has spent quite a bit of time and money updating the Touareg for the 2015 model year. BMW Alpina B3 Bi-Turbo (2013) first official pictures
Thu, 28 Feb 2013Alpina has revealed the first teaser shots of its hot 3-series supersaloon, the B3 BiTurbo, which packs 404bhp and 442lb ft. It's a BMW M3 by another name.
